Citrus Dill Baked Cod
Citrus dill baked cod is a fresh light meal that comes together in less than 20 minutes. It's easy, low-fat, and delicious...Not to mention zero WW points.

- 10 Ounces Cod Fish Or other white fish
- ½ teaspoon Adobo Seasoning Optional
- 1 Lemon
- 1 Lime
- 3-4 Sprigs Fresh Dill
- Sea Salt to taste
Preheat the oven to 375 degrees. Cut a piece of aluminum foil large enough to wrap around the fish fillet. Rinse and pat dry the fillet with a papertowel, then place it in the center of the aluminum foil.
If using adobo seasoning, sprinkle on the fish. Or use your favorite seasoning. Lemon pepper is also a really good option.
Slice Lemon and Lime
Alternating lemon and lime, add the slices to the top of the fish
Add the fresh dill sprigs to the top of the lemon and lime slices on the fish
Fold the foil around the fish. The easiest way is to bring the center together and fold at the top. Then, wrap the sides like a present with the seams up to keep in juices
Place a foil packet on a baking sheet and bake in the oven for 15 minutes. Depending on the thickness of your fish it may take longer. Check after 15 minutes. Fish should flake with a fork and be firm to the touch in the middle. You can also use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ature
Serve with a salad and enjoy
